The Homer Trojans will venture away from home to square off against the Marcellus Mustangs at 7:30 p.m. on Wednesday. Both have had a bumpy ride up to this point with three consecutive losses apiece.
Homer's offense might be in the hot seat on Wednesday considering what happened against Chittenango on Tuesday. They fell 2-0 to the Bears.
Meanwhile, Marcellus also failed to score in their most recent game. They fell just short of Christian Brothers Academy by a score of 1-0 two weeks ago. That's two games in a row now that the Mustangs have lost by just one goal.
Homer's loss dropped their record down to 0-3. As for Marcellus, their defeat dropped their record down to an identical 0-3.
Homer came up short against Marcellus in their previous matchup back in October of 2022, falling 2-0. Can Homer av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
